Hangzhou Medisage Medical Co., Ltd. was founded in 2001 with an unwavering commitment to redefining surgical intervention standards. Its primary manufacturing base, Shuangyang Medical, located in Zhangjiagang City, Jiangsu Province, spans a state-of-the-art facility area of 18,000㎡, with an ultra-clean production floor exceeding 15,000㎡ and a registered capital of 20 million Yuan.

Specializing in the research, custom design, and industrial-scale production of advanced orthopedic implant systems and precision surgical instruments, Medisage integrates cutting-edge titanium machining, biomechanical modeling, and surface chemistry to provide OEM/ODM innovation solutions worldwide.

With over two decades of technical domain experience, Medisage has solidified its position as a authoritative OEM manufacturer. Guided by the philosophy of "people-oriented, integrity first, continuous innovation, and pursuit of excellence," our comprehensive portfolio spans trauma fixation plates, intramedullary nails, spinal poly-axial systems, cranial/maxillofacial devices, power surgical drills, and specialized veterinary implants.

Industry Whitepaper Analysis

Technological Innovations Reshaping Global Orthopedics

An in-depth analysis of emerging biomechanical breakthroughs, smart implants, and material transformations driving modern surgical care.

1. Additive Manufacturing & 3D Porous Titanium Structures

Traditional solid titanium implants often suffer from modulus mismatch leading to stress shielding and long-term bone resorption. Modern OEM solutions are pivoting toward 3D-printed Trabecular Titanium structures. By replicating native cancellous bone porosity (60-80% porosity with 300–600μm pore size), these innovative constructs encourage rapid osseointegration, direct bone ingrowth, and enhanced mechanical stability at the bone-implant interface.

2. Variable Angle Locking Technology (VA-LCP)

Rigid fixed-angle locking screws are increasingly replaced by Variable-Angle Locking Compression Plate (VA-LCP) platforms. Surgeons can direct locking screws within a 30-degree conical trajectory. This provides unprecedented intraoperative flexibility for complex intra-articular fractures, osteoporotic bone fixation, and customized fragment targeting without compromising overall mechanical rigidity or construct stability.

3. PEEK Polymers & Composite Biomaterials

Polyetheretherketone (PEEK) and carbon-fiber reinforced PEEK are revolutionizing spine interbody fusion and oncological trauma implants. Exhibiting an elastic modulus closely mimicking natural cortical bone, PEEK eliminates artifact interference under MRI and CT imaging, providing radiolucency that enables post-operative bone fusion evaluation while eliminating stress shielding.

4. Smart Implants & Sensor-Integrated Monitoring

The frontier of orthopedic innovation lies in telemetry-enabled smart implants. Incorporating micro-MEMS strain sensors and passive RFID chips, these devices allow non-invasive real-time tracking of post-surgical mechanical loads, micromotion, fracture healing progression, and early infection indicators via localized thermal variation, transforming passive fixators into active diagnostic systems.

Knowledge Base

Frequently Asked Questions by Technical Procurement Teams

Clear insights regarding our OEM custom manufacturing processes, material certifications, and regulatory support.

What raw medical materials do you utilize for custom orthopedic implant manufacturing?

We primarily utilize medical-grade Titanium Alloys (Ti-6Al-4V ELI conforming to ASTM F136 / ISO 5832-3), Commercially Pure Titanium (Grade 2 & Grade 4), Polyetheretherketone (PEEK-OPTIMA), and high-grade stainless steel (316LVM / ISO 5832-1). All materials are supplied with full heat-lot mill certificates and biometrical traceability.

How does Medisage support custom OEM design transfer and prototyping?

Our internal design team collaborates directly with client CAD models (STEP/IGES). We perform DFM feasibility analysis, FEA stress analysis, rapid prototyping via 5-axis CNC, and biomechanical static/dynamic fatigue testing before transitioning to full production validation (IQ/OQ/PQ).

What quality certifications does your manufacturing site possess?

Shuangyang Medical operates under an ISO 13485:2016 audited Quality Management System. Our key product lines maintain CE certifications under EU MDR guidelines, and our manufacturing facilities adhere strictly to FDA Good Manufacturing Practices (GMP / 21 CFR Part 820).

Can you accommodate custom surface treatments and color anodization?

Yes. We provide automated Type II and Type III anodization, electrochemical polishing, sandblasting, micro-bead blasting, laser marking for UDI (Unique Device Identification) tracking, and custom color-coding for titanium locking plates and screws to simplify surgical identification.

What is your standard production lead time for custom surgical instrument sets?

Initial prototype sample verification takes approximately 2 to 3 weeks. Mass production orders typically range between 30 and 45 calendar days, depending on product complexity, surface coating specifications, and cleanroom packaging requirements.
